Friendly, accommodating staff. Spotlessly clean, well-maintained campground. The pristine pool was a welcome relief from the 100 degree heat. Totally recommended the Tamarisk restaurant next door on the Green River. Only detractor was the size of our tent site; luckily we brought our smaller (4-man) tent, as our 12x15 ft one didn't fit. We'll be back again but with our RV.

It’s a great stopping place between Salt Lake City and is about 40 miles from Moab. I don’t recommend it for tent camping (no shade, lights at night, lots of mosquitos) but RV spots are great. Has a pool. Staff is very knowledgeable.

Update: We always stay here on our annual trip to the west coast. Have never had a bad experience. They added more spaces, and it's made the park even nicer. Just a quick one night stay, but liked the place. Requested a back in space instead because there were large, shade trees there in the 102 degree day. Probably the largest space we've ever parked in. Decent grassy area out our door. The pull throughs didn't have the grass, so it was another reason to request a back in. Large pool for a KOA, 8 foot deep, took a quick swim. Didn't go into the bathrooms, or laundry room, so I can't comment as to those. Amazing WiFi for an RV park. Granted there weren't many people there, but it was a nice change. Would most definitely stay again passing through. EDIT: Did stay here again while passing through. A great, little oasis in the Utah desert. Went into the bathroom/shower area this time, and it was clean, and very usable.
